Constructions Defaults

The Defaults Manager: Constructions panel contains controls used to set material construction defaults for building elements such as walls, partitions, floors. ceilings, roofs, windows and doors and to set default dimensions for plenums, windows, doors and surface components.

The defaults set here are used for either the active project if they are made in Defaults Manager’s Project mode, or on all new projects if they are set in Defaults Manager’s Application mode.

Wall Walls added to a room will default to the construction selected here. The selected construction will be automatically applied to walls created when using the two room defining tools Trace (Room) and Define (Room) .
Partition Partitions will default to the construction selected here. The selected construction will be automatically applied when a wall is added and changes an exposed wall into a partition.
Window Windows added to walls will default to the construction selected here. The selected construction will appear in the Add Window tool’s Fabric type setting by default.
Door Doors will default to the construction selected here. The selected construction will appear in the Add Door tool’s Fabric type setting by default.
Internal ceiling Internal ceilings will default to the construction selected here. The selected construction will be automatically applied when a floor is added above an exposed roof, changing it into an internal ceiling.
Exposed floor Exposed floors will default to the construction selected here. The selected construction will be automatically applied when a floor is added that is exposed to the ground.
Internal floor Internal floors will default to the construction selected here. The selected construction will be automatically applied when a floor is added above an internal ceiling, changing it into an internal floor.
Roof Roofs will default to the construction selected here. The selected construction will be automatically applied to roofs that are setup on a floor.
Rooflight Rooflights will default to the construction selected here. The selected construction will be automatically applied to rooflights defined with the Add Opening tool.
Floor height The floor to floor height of rooms will default to the height defined here. Floor height is distributed between the room height and plenum heights. The sum of the plenums and room heights must equal Floor height, however Room height can exceed Floor height for rooms that span multiple stories (atria).
Room height The height of the rooms will default to the height defined here. Room height can be equal to (no plenums specified), but can exceed Floor height for rooms that span multiple stories (atria).

Wall height The height of walls will default to the wall height defined here. The entered wall height value will appear in the two room defining tools Trace and Define.
Partition height The height of partitions will default to the partition height defined here. The entered partition height value will be automatically applied when a wall is added and changes an exposed wall into a partition.
Opening heights
  • Window height — Where windows with enclosing walls are defined, windows will have a vertical height defined by the default window height entered here. The entered window height value will appear in the Add Window tool’s Height setting.
  • Sill height — Where windows with enclosing walls are defined, window sills will be located at the sill height (measured from the floor) value defined here. The entered sill height value will appear in the Add Window tool’s Sill height setting.
  • Door height — Where doors with enclosing walls are defined, doors will have a vertical height defined by the default door height value entered here. The entered door height value will appear in the Add Door tool’s Height setting.
  • Door base height — Where doors with enclosing walls are defined, doors will have a door base height (measured from the floor) value defined here. The entered door height value will appear in the Add Door tool’s Base height setting.
Surface component size All surface components graphics are placed with the height and width dimensions defined here. Surface component graphics are mainly used to create the hierarchical relationship with their parent surfaces (walls, ceilings, floors or partitions). The surface component’s associated data depends upon its surface component type. These data are then considered during energy simulation and calculation.
  • Height — Sets surface component graphics’ default height dimension. Height is always measured relative to the Y axis (up/down in a plan or top view) regardless of the AccuDraw Compass orientation.
  • Width — Sets surface component graphics’ default width dimension. Width is always measured relative to the X axis (left/right in a plan or top view) regardless of the AccuDraw Compass orientation.
